Job description
Commercial Litigation Associate – 12-15 Month Fixed-Term Contract

Location: London (Hybrid – 3 days per week in the office)

Salary: circa £110,000

The Firm

Our client, a Top 100 law firm with a rich history, renowned for delivering exceptional legal services to businesses, entrepreneurs, and high-net-worth individuals. The firm combines deep-rooted traditions with a modern, agile approach.

The Role

The firm is seeking an experienced Litigation Associate (6+ PQE) to join the firm’s highly regarded Litigation team on a 12-15 month fixed-term contract. This is an excellent opportunity to work on complex, high-value disputes within a collaborative and dynamic environment.

Key Responsibilities

  • Manage a diverse caseload of commercial litigation matters, including contractual disputes, shareholder and partnership disputes, and civil fraud claims.
  • Advise clients on strategy and risk management in contentious situations.
  • Draft pleadings, witness statements, and other key litigation documents to a high standard.
  • Represent clients in court proceedings and arbitration, ensuring effective advocacy and negotiation.
  • Work closely with partners and senior stakeholders to deliver pragmatic, commercially focused solutions.

Skills & Experience Required

  • Qualified solicitor with 6+ years PQE in litigation and dispute resolution with experience gained at a Top 100 or US law firm.
  • Strong technical expertise in commercial litigation, including experience with high-value and complex disputes.
  • Familiarity with shareholder disputes, insolvency-related claims, and fraud matters.
  • Experience acting for ultra-high net worth clients would be a distinct advantage, bit is not essential.
  • Excellent drafting, analytical, and advocacy skills.
  • Ability to manage cases independently and maintain strong client relationships.

Why Apply?

  • Exposure to high-profile, challenging cases in a supportive and collegiate team.
  • Hybrid working model: 3 days per week in the office, 2 days remote.
  • Opportunity to join a firm with a long-standing reputation and modern outlook.
